Northside Northline, Houston, TX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Northside Northline?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Northside Northline 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,691 | $850 | $2,500 |
| Northside Northline 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,390 | $1,350 | $4,950 |
| Northside Northline 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,394 | $1,975 | $2,995 |
| Northside Northline 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$11,500 | $7,500 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Northside Northline
What type of rentals are currently available in Northside Northline?
There are currently 147 Apartments for Rent in Northside Northline, TX with pricing that ranges from $766 to $7,652. There are also 189 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Northside Northline ranging from $850 to $16,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Northside Northline?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Northside Northline ranges from $850 to $16,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,942.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Northside Northline?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Northside Northline range from $1,112 to $7,652,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,350 to $4,950.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,975 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,220.
